description |
Restorative Beach Resort in Nusa Dua, Bali is a fictional project with the main function of hospitality in the form of a beach resort located in Jl. Raya Nusa Dua Selatan, Benoa, South Kuta District, Badung Regency, Bali. Standing on a land area of 8.5 hectares, this project was initiated by PT. Oriental Bali Indah Hotel and targets tourists as its main users.
The emergence of this project was motivated by the diversity of individual activities to meet their daily needs. These activities require attention which if done continuously will cause mental fatigue. Thus, it requires directed attention without effort as counter attention. This is what is known as restorative. According to Kaplan, restorative is divided into the aspects of being away, extent, fascination, and compatibility. These aspects are in line with recreational needs, tourism potential, and locality problems in Bali. Thus, the project's vision emerged, which is to create a resort that is able to provide a restorative effect for its visitors by elevating Balinese culture through the formation of local communities and Balinese characteristics as well as creating quality spaces and supporting facilities.
Located in an exclusive area, the facilities provided are complete and varied. Namely the front of the house along with the back of the house, gymnasium, swimming pool, yoga bale, spa, wedding chapel, and beach club. The room types are divided into three, namely superior suite, deluxe suite, and president suite. Site and building planning use traditional Balinese conceptions including nawasanga to determine the position of the main building, natah, and temple. In addition, the mass of the building uses the tri angga concept which divides the building into the head, body and legs. Massing and building orientation also consider the beach as a selling point of the site. The design of the space is made in such a way to create an attractive space experience for its users. |
